1. What is Monthly Rent Calculation?

The monthly rent calculation converts an annual rental amount into equivalent monthly payments. This is commonly used in real estate and leasing agreements to determine periodic payment amounts.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the simple formula:

\[ \text{Monthly Rent} = \frac{\text{Annual Rent}}{12} \]

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Does this calculation account for rent increases?
A: No, this is a simple annual-to-monthly conversion. For variable rent agreements, more complex calculations are needed.

Q2: Should I include utilities in the annual rent amount?
A: Only if utilities are included in your rental agreement. Otherwise, calculate them separately.

Q3: What if rent is paid quarterly or weekly?
A: For quarterly payments, divide annual rent by 4. For weekly, divide by 52 (or 52.143 for more precision).

Q4: Does this work for commercial leases?
A: Yes, the same calculation applies, though commercial leases often have more complex payment structures.

Q5: How does this compare to daily rent calculation?
A: For daily rent, divide annual rent by 365 (or 365.25 to account for leap years).
